    That brake squeal is fixable. Gotta remove the pads and put a small bit of brake pad grease (or silicone) on the back side of the pads that touch the piston. EDIT: do NOT put the grease on the side of the pad that touches the disc!!!

      You can try setting the bike in the display to not turn off by itself then turn the lights on and leave them on for a while it would probably take a long time to drain the battery down this way but it should over time. I would not store the batteries at 100% I would drain them down some to around 60% and keep the batteries in heated storage.

      Yeah, I find the torque output of the XP 3.0 to be less than awe-inspiring. Acceleration in throttle-only mode is modest and top speed is only about 17.5 to 18 mph.
      Performance in pedal-assist mode is pretty good, although to get past 25 mph you have to put in quite a bit of physical effort.
      Similarly, hill climbing is satisfactory (within reason) in pedal-assist mode in lower gears, but there again, throttle-only mode is not what I would use for that.
